Soul-Melting Talisman

**The Soul-Melting Talisman (融灵符)** — This isn’t just a clever plot device; it’s a brilliant illustration of the Mortal Stream’s “cooperation is a luxury” principle. The talisman is a high-cost, medium-reliability tool (a 50% success rate and exorbitant price) designed to defy the world’s brutal separation mechanic. The fact that it exists at all tells you that the system is so hostile to teamwork that cultivators are forced to invent rare, expensive workarounds just to have a trusted battle buddy. The Skysky Fortress man’s logic is the perfect encapsulation of Dark Forest economics: “Don’t compete for the prize everyone is fighting over. Instead, prey on those competitors from a position of superior strength.” This is the textbook definition of the “kill the goose” economy—why farm spirit herbs when you can rob the farmers?

Story context

Hold onto your spirit stones, folks—because the gloves are off, and Han Li has just walked into the worst possible scenario. This chapter is a masterclass in Mortal Stream tension: our favorite cautious protagonist, fresh off the teleportation pad of the Blood Forbidden Land, finds himself cornered by two friendly veteran cultivators who treat an eleventh-layer rookie like a quick cash grab. What follows isn’t a flashy duel of epic magic, but a slow, grinding tactical nightmare. Han Li’s internal calculation engine is running at full speed as he measures his trump cards against a coordinated duo, and the chapter sets up a striking contrast between the ambushers’ arrogant confidence and their prey’s cold-blooded resource management. Get ready for the moment the Heaven Thunder Seed enters the negotiation table.

Why it matters

This chapter is a masterful escalation of the novel’s core tension. Up until now, Han Li has faced outnumbered fights within the sect on a martial-arts scale. Here, for the first time, he faces a true cultivation-world ambush by a coordinated duo who have experience, camaraderie, and a dedicated plan of action. Pay close attention to Han Li’s moment of “calculated frustration” when he realizes the bearded man has cast a protective spell—it’s a rare moment where his internal “run the numbers” algorithm hits a snag. His immediate pivot to the Skysky Fortress disciple is a textbook example of Mortal Stream resource management: never lock yourself into a losing matchup if a softer target exists. The Heaven Thunder Seed is now a Chekhov’s gun that has been placed very prominently on the table. Every reader knows it’s a game-changer, so the tension isn’t about “if” Han Li can win, but “what price is he willing to pay” to avoid using it. That’s the devilish essence of this world: victory is often less about raw power and more about the strategic acceptance of loss.
